AAPL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

4,548 of the 6,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Apple (AAPL)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$1.25T — down 3.7% from $1.3T a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 408 funds opened new AAPL positions and 101 closed out — a net gain of 307 holders — while 1,560 added to existing stakes and 2,328 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$3.71B. The largest seller was Janus Henderson Group, cutting an estimated $5.7B.
